Transaction f81f39371fbb252158b674471cd23589761b27897c4d30753444a31f47aa843a
1 Input
2 Outputs
- f81f39371fbb252158b674471cd23589761b27897c4d30753444a31f47aa843a:0
- f81f39371fbb252158b674471cd23589761b27897c4d30753444a31f47aa843a:1
value 20000000
address 1Gk1RxcthDmTtgLewaHwF4AYCJwWKUT18d
value 45349951
address 34aPdnCZZTEu6d3iLNtbLL4uCMQen1fJvw